OpenText Functional Testing for Developers and Galen Framework are both automated testing tools competing in software testing. OpenText seems to have an advantage in advanced features and customer support, while Galen excels in visual testing capabilities.
Features: OpenText Functional Testing for Developers provides cross-platform testing, integration with CI/CD pipelines, and advanced automation functionalities. Galen Framework supports responsive layout testing, UI testing, and ensuring visual consistency across devices.
Ease of Deployment and Customer Service: OpenText Functional Testing for Developers has a structured deployment model with comprehensive customer support, making integration smoother. Galen Framework is easy to install for rapid usage but has limited customer service support.
Pricing and ROI: OpenText Functional Testing for Developers involves higher setup costs but offers significant ROI through reduced testing time and comprehensive support. Galen Framework is more affordable, providing compelling ROI for businesses focusing on layout validation.

Layout testing seemed always a complex task. Galen Framework offers a simple solution: test location of objects relatively to each other on page. Using a special syntax and comprehensive rules you can describe any layout you can imagine.
Galen Framework runs well in Selenium Grid. You can set up your tests to run in a cloud like Sauce Labs or BrowserStack so that you can even test your responsive websites on different mobile devices. Galen can run multiple tests in parallel which is also a nice time saver.
Galen Framework is designed with responsivness in mind. It is easy to set up a test for different browser sizes. Galen just opens a browser, resizes it to a defined size and then tests the page according to specifications.
OpenText Functional Testing for Developers offers robust automation capabilities with support for complex algorithms, multi-platform testing, and developer-friendly integration using C# and Java, facilitating seamless testing transitions and efficient automation workflows.
This testing tool is highly valued for its integration with ALM and Jenkins, along with its developer-focused environment adaptable to Eclipse and Visual Studio. With AI-based object recognition, an object repository, and test framework integration, it bolsters DevOps practices while reducing IT workloads. Supporting UFT to LeanFT transition, it caters to SAP, Java, .NET environments, and more. Enhanced with stable automation, extensive protocol support, and both on-premises and cloud deployments, it targets performance, regression, and functional testing, while recording and screengrabs enhance automation capabilities. Future improvements could include expanded browser compatibility, enhanced JavaScript and mobile support, and better object recognition.
